Interesting details:

  • We have a better ambient occlusion option now.
  • DLSS/FSR is available.
  • Character lighting is smoother, eyes are better, mouth animation is amazing, hair looks better. Sadly difficult to see in the character generation due to the lighting but if you let the benchmark play with it, it becomes rather obvious.
  • When selecting voices for a character, you can now also select which type of emote you want to hear as an example.
